Booking now for summer and fall 2012. Complete privacy on 8 ½ wooded acres just three miles from Freeport Village and LL Bean, five miles from the ocean, twenty minutes from Portland, fifteen minutes from Brunswick.

The home is fully furnished, with three bedrooms, a gourmet kitchen, fireplace, spacious deck with hot tub, well-maintained gardens, garage, cable, and wireless internet. Even a baby grand piano! The master suite with double vanity is at one end of the house, the other two bedrooms at the other end with their own shared bathroom.

Ideal home base for summer vacation, foliage season, or winter getaways.

This is a peaceful, private setting - you can't see or hear the neighbors. The view in every direction, including from the oversized deck, is gardens and trees. We have deer and turkey sightings regularly. The stars at night are brilliant, and especially wonderful viewed from the hot tub.

Enjoy the coast of Maine without paying waterfront rates, and spread out and relax in this 2,000 square foot property.

We built this house in 1997. Circumstances have taken me to Oregon, but I plan to keep the house and return to it. So this isn't just a rental property -- it's my home. I'm pleased to be able to share it, and it's a house that really should be full of life all the time.

I work in healthcare marketing and public relations, which is what brought me out here. We run a small wine brokerage on the side, bringing Oregon and Washington wines back to Maine. (You can find them at Freeport Cheese and Wine in Freeport.)

We had two dogs when we lived there, and that's why we're pet-friendly. I've not had problems in 3 years of renting, except for one party. So I'm keeping it pet-friendly.

Everything you see on the exterior, from the foundation walls out, I did. Deck, plantings, etc. I'm fortunate to have my brother as my property manager, and he's keeping everything up for me.

I love Oregon, but it has made me appreciate the pace and privacy in Maine. People are packed pretty tightly here, whereas at my Maine home I can't even see the neighbors. I think that privacy is one of the best features of the house.
